Organization: Advanced Weapons And Equipment India Limited, under the Department Of Defence Production, invites bids for casting of body for AK-630 M gun (DRG. NO. C 2267) with reference to travelling retainer. The tender lacks explicit start/end dates and a published estimated value or EMD; however, it specifies an inspection regime and a 1-year warranty. A key differentiation is the inclusion of an option clause allowing quantity variation up to 25% during contract execution at contracted rates, with delivery time adjustments linked to original delivery periods. Bidders must anticipate Indian defence procurement norms, ensure GST considerations, and align with supplier-code creation requirements. Unique clauses include on-site post-receipt inspection by CGM/GSF and DQAN, NEW DELHI, and mandatory material test certificates with supply acceptance driven by buyer lab results.

The tender specifies casting of the body for AK-630 M gun with DRG C2267; no explicit dimensions provided. Emphasize compliance with Material Test Certificate and ensure readiness for post-receipt inspection by CGM/GSF and DQAN, NEW DELHI, with OEM warranty documentation.
Delivery timing follows the last date of the original delivery order. If quantity increases under the option clause, additional time equals (Increased quantity ÷ Original quantity) × Original delivery period, with a minimum of 30 days. Full contract extension possible up to original delivery period.
A 1 year warranty begins from final product acceptance or after installation/testing. OEM warranty certificates must be supplied at delivery. The manufacturer must have installation, commissioning, and maintenance service capabilities across India to support post-warranty service.
Pre-dispatch inspection at seller premises by CGM/GSF or DQAN, NEW DELHI is possible if ATC permits; post-receipt inspection occurs at the consignee site before acceptance by CGM/GSF and DQAN. Material Test Certificate is mandatory with the supplied items.
Bidders must determine applicable GST; reimbursement by the buyer will align with actual GST or the quoted GST rate, whichever is lower, subject to the maximum quoted GST percentage. Ensure GST compliance documentation accompanies the bid.
Bid submission must include PAN, GSTIN, cancelled cheque, and EFT mandate certified by bank. These documents enable vendor-code creation and eligibility checks for participation in the AW&E defence procurement process.
